Business

Response:

The customer inaccurately states he has been unfairly placed in the

“Bad Sports” or “Cheater” pool for multiplayer matchmaking in GTAOnline.

The Bad Sport pool is triggered by things like quitting games early, blowing up

other people’s vehicles, and being reported manually or voted out by other

players from the in-game pause menu. The Cheater Pool is where players

who cheat or exploit are put. These customers can still play the

GTAOnline multiplayer game, but they are “matched” with other players with

similar histories for a limited amount of time. If they cease their

negative behavior, they will be removed from the Bad Sport or Cheater pool

again. This customer’s GTA Online account shows that he was repeatedly reported

as a Bad Sport by other players for “Annoying Players” and “Griefing” (which

means causing “grief” to other players by interfering with their games in an

unsportsmanlike manner). The customer has since been removed from the Bad

Sport pool but he may be placed in it again if his actions are not

sportsmanlike. This customer is complaining about the proper functioning of the

built-in disciplinary process of the game which is not the purpose or intent of

the Revdex.com system. This complaint should be closed and resolved in favor of the

Company.

Business

Response:

Grand Theft Auto V allows customers a one-time only opportunity to transfer their game progress from an old generation console (Xbox 360 or PS3) to a new generation console (Xbox One or PS4). The customer transferred his character progress once and then requested to transfer a second time. Support appropriately explained that this option is only available once which prompted the customer’s complaint. We have contacted the customer once again to resolve the issue. This complaint should be closed and resolved in favor of the Company. This is our last comment on the matter.
